- Zhob_District abstract "Zhob (Pashto: ژوب) is a district in the north west of Balochistan province of Pakistan. Zhob district is a Provincially Administered Tribal Area (PATA). Zhob district is subdivided into three subdistricts: Zhob, Kakkar and Sherani. The population of Zhob district is estimated to be over 200,000 in 2005. Zhob River is used for irrigation in the Zhob district.".
